For instance, SQLite has no option to do Right or Full Outer Joins, and the serverless nature can also be a disadvantage for security and protection against data misuse. One such exception is integer primary key columns, which can only store integers.Īs with most things though, there are also some limitations of SQLite with respect to other database engines. Note that there are some exceptions to this rule. However, SQLite uses manifest typing, which allows the storage of any amount of any data type into any column without no matter the column's declared datatype. That is, you can only store values of the same datatype that is associated with a particular column. Manifest Typing: The majority of SQL database engines rely on static typing.This also makes it simple to share since database files can easily be copied onto a memory stick or sent through email. Simple Database Files: A SQLite database is a single ordinary disk file that can be stored in any directory.There is no need for database administrators to assign instances or manage user access permissions. No need for servers: That is, there are no server processes that need to start, stop or be configured.However, SQLite is another useful RDBMS that is very simple to set up and operate that has many distinct features over other relational databases. If you are familiar with relational database systems, it is likely that you have heard of heavyweights such as MySQL, SQL Server or PostgreSQL.
